Looks like too much parallelism. Your backup is waiting on both reads and
writes but mostly on reads. How many channels are you using? Also, it looks
like the array is VNX. How is it attached? Is it iSCSI or F/C? If it's
iSCSI, do you have iSCSI HBA boards or just plain simple 10 Gb Ethernet?
VNX is not an enterprise class array for DB servers. You should consider
something like Pure (cheaper) or XTremIO (more expensive).

Hi,
Env is 2 node RAC (12.2 GI + RDBMS) on Linux.
We are seeing significant amount of IO wait during level 0 backups (weekly
once) and level 1 backups (daily). RMAN backup is running on Node A and
Golden Gate is running on Node B. The below are some artifacts
